What are the differences between data structures in C++17?
C++17 introduced several enhancements to data structures. For instance, std::optional, std::variant, and std::any were added. These provide more flexible ways to handle data.
Can you explain how std::optional works?
Sure! std::optional is a wrapper that can contain a value or be empty. It's useful for functions that may not return a value.
How does std::variant differ from std::any?
std::variant can hold one of several specified types, while std::any can hold any type. This makes std::variant safer and more efficient for known types.
Are there performance implications when using these new structures?
Yes, std::optional and std::variant can improve performance by avoiding unnecessary heap allocations, but their overhead depends on usage patterns.
